Kingston Sailing Club was well represented at the season's two first HRYRA events and all three boats collected silver at the Chelsea Yacht Club regatta last weekend with Puck III and Sterling finishing second in the A & B Fleet respectively and Innovator placing third in the B Fleet. A week earlier Sterling & Innovator again finished second and third at the Hudson Cove regatta. Congratulations to skippers & crews. The Kingston Sailing Club
(KSC) coordinates and hosts weekly sailboat races for its members on the Hudson River, near Kingston,
New York.
There is a spring and fall series of 16 races each,
including the annual Maritime Cup
Regatta in June and the Spinnenweber Cup Regatta in the fall. In addition KSC hosts the
Mid Hudson Long Distance Regatta in August in association
with the Norrie Point Sailing Club and the Poughkeepsie Yacht Club.
During the racing season skippers' meetings
are held every Sunday at 10am under the KSC tent at the Hudson River
Maritime Museum on the Roundout in Kingston. We welcome new skippers and
crew to attend. |
